Developing Ideas of Attribute While Reading to Babies

Developing Ideas of Attribute While Reading to Babies

Before true mathematical thought develops in childhood, reading to babies can help them explore precursor concepts of math. A caregiver reads a touch-and-feel book to an infant in her care. The emphasis is on supporting the child’s receptive understanding of attributes perceived through touch.

The child’s language is an advanced babble stage. While he isn’t vocalizing any recognizable words, his intonation makes it clear when he is asking a question or making a statement.
